Just some random improvisation, demoing the Engl E530 preamp. This was recorded using the E530's built-in 1.5w solid-state poweramp.

Chain: LTD MH400 with EMG 81 --- Engl E530 --- Framus Dragon 412st. No boosts, no effects, nothing. This is pure E530.

All settings weren't far from 12 o'clock - this thing literally took me around 10 seconds to dial in! Lead chanel, hi gain, contour off. Lead gain is about 2 o'clock

  • Do you need to put this through a power amp before the cabinet to get it to amplify?

  • @Gyro911 This preamp has a built-in 1.5w poweramp, which will get you loud enough to generally jam, etc, but you wouldn't get loud enough to compete with a drummer, though you may get away with playing like through a full PA, depending on the size of the venue you're playing (i.e, small venue)
